First Line of Defense: Smart Agriculture

Farming... it feeds us, yes, BUT it can also be a big polluter if we're not careful. Think about it: fertilizers, pesticides... they all wash into our waterways.

So what’s the fix? Well, smart farming practices! Things like using less fertilizer (seriously, plants don't need a mountain of it!), using natural pest control instead of those nasty chemicals (ladybugs are your friends!), and planting buffer zones along rivers and streams. Think of them as leafy bodyguards against runoff. Pretty cool, huh?

Wastewater Treatment: The Unsung Hero

Okay, this might not be the most glamorous topic, but hear me out! Wastewater treatment plants are basically the superheroes of clean water. They take all that yucky water from our homes and businesses (yes, that water!) and clean it up before it gets released back into the environment.

The problem? Not all plants are created equal. Some are outdated and not as effective. So, investing in upgrading wastewater treatment infrastructure is KEY. Plus, things like constructed wetlands can help naturally filter water. Nature's own little cleaning crew!

Industrial Waste: Taming the Beast

Industries... they're essential for our economy, sure, but they can also be major sources of pollution. (Deep sigh.) Factories often release chemicals and other pollutants into the water, and it's a problem!

So, what can we do? Well, stricter regulations are a must! Companies need to be held accountable for their waste and forced to clean up their act (literally!). Plus, promoting cleaner production technologies is a great way to prevent pollution in the first place. Prevention is always better than cure, right?

Stormwater Management: When Rain Becomes the Enemy

Rain! It's refreshing, life-giving... and can also be a major source of pollution. Wait, what? Yep! As rainwater flows over roads, parking lots, and other surfaces, it picks up all sorts of pollutants (oil, chemicals, trash) and carries them into our waterways.

The solution? Green infrastructure! Think rain gardens, green roofs, and permeable pavements. These things help to absorb stormwater and filter out pollutants before they reach our rivers and lakes. Plus, they make our cities look prettier! It's a win-win!
